Florida State University leads bar exam pass rate in February

Florida State University leads bar exam pass rate in February After a series of hishaps, Florida finally managed to administer the Bar Exam. Pass rate percentages ranged from the high 30s to 78. Florida State University College of Law leads the state in the percentage of first-time bar exam test-takers in February who passed the test required for admittance into the Florida Bar. Though the school had significantly fewer test-takers than other schools, of FSU’s nine examinees, seven passed the exam, or just under 78%. The next most successful school in the February cohort was Florida International University College of Law, with a 75% pass rate among its 20 first-time exam-takers.

Wozniak appointed to 5th DCA Gov. Ron DeSantis has appointed Carrie Ann Wozniak, of Winter Park, to serve on the 5th District Court of Appeal. She fills the spot of Judge Richard Orfinger, who retired. The court s jurisdiction includes Marion County. Wozniak has been a partner at Akerman LLP, a top 100 U.S. law firm, since 2013, DeSantis office said in a news release. She previously served as a staff attorney at the Florida Supreme Court. The Marbut Report: Farah & Farah growing the family business | Jax Daily Record | Jacksonville Daily Record

The Law Offices of Eddie Farah was established in 1980 after firm founder Eddie Farah graduated from Cumberland School of Law at Samford University. In 1990, his brother, Chuck, graduated from Cumberland and the firm’s name changed to Farah & Farah. The third and fourth Farahs now are practicing in the firm: Eddie Farah’s son, Khalil, and daughter, Dalya. “I never pushed them to do it, but it’s a family affair at this point,” said Eddie Farah. “They don’t get any special treatment. They’re handling cases just like everybody else.” Khalil Farah, 30, joined the firm in 2015. A graduate of Florida State University College of Law, he focuses his practice on representing people who’ve been injured in automobile accidents and premises liability.
